CSS是一種用于控制網頁樣式的語言,它可以幫助我們設計出更加美觀和高效的網頁。不過,在實際應用中,有一些情況下我們需要強制文本不換行,這可能涉及到問題的排版和布局。下面我們將介紹如何使用CSS來強制不換行。
首先,我們需要知道CSS中有一個屬性叫做“white-space”,它可以用來控制文本的空白符處理方式。在默認情況下,文本會根據其所在容器大小自動換行,但我們可以通過設置該屬性的值來實現不換行。
在CSS中,該屬性的取值有三種:normal、nowrap和pre。其中,normal是默認值,表示讓文本根據需要自動換行;nowrap表示不允許換行,即使文本內容超出容器大小也不會自動換行;而pre則表示保留文本中的所有換行、空格和制表符,而不進行任何折行的處理。
下面我們通過一個例子來演示如何通過設置“white-space”屬性來實現不換行效果:
<style type="text/css"> p{ border: 1px solid black; /*設置邊框*/ width: 200px; /*設置寬度*/ white-space: nowrap; /*不允許換行*/ } </style> <p>這是一段很長很長很長很長很長很長的文本,但是我們不想讓它自動在以上代碼中,我們通過設置“white-space”屬性的值為nowrap,使得文本內容即使超出容器大小也不會自動換行。這樣,我們就可以得到一段不換行的文本。 總的來說,CSS中的“white-space”屬性可以幫助我們在特定情況下實現不換行的效果。但是,由于每個網頁的情況都不同,使用該屬性時需要根據實際情況進行調整和靈活運用。
換行,而是想讓它一整行顯示出來。</p>
上一篇css媒體查詢分欄
下一篇ajax多個請求順序執行